WebPlasma is the liquid portion of blood. About 55% of our blood is plasma, and the remaining 45% are red blood cells, white blood cells and platelets that are suspended in the plasma. Plasma is about 92% water. It also contains 7% vital proteins such as albumin, gamma globulin and anti-hemophilic factor, and 1% mineral salts, sugars, fats ... WebKeep track of how much water you drink throughout the day. Discuss the importance of water for the body to function properly, including carrying nutrients in and taking waste out of the body. All parts of the body contain some water for example: lungs consist of 80% water. bones consist of 22% water. muscles contain 75% water.
